>Wasn't it Noam L. who wrote:
>>I'm trying to move a sphere in an animation, and I notice that the
>>checkers pattern doesn't "stick" to the sphere.
>>I tried using uv_mapping but then only the first color of the checker
>>is used as the pigment of the sphere.
>>
>>How do I move a sphere and make the initial checkers pattern "stick"
>>to it?
>
>
>  texture {uv_mapping pigment {checker} scale <0.1, 0.147> }
>
>With uv_mapping, the part of the texture that would normally cover the
>square from <0,0> to <1,1> is mapped to the whole surface, even if the
>sphere is much larger than that. But for the checker pattern, each of
>the coloured checkers is a 1x1 square, so to see any pattern you need to
>scale down.
>
>[Because the pattern is in uv-space instead of xyz-space, only the first
>two dimensions of scaling are meaningful.]
